Harley Davidson rally in Montjuïc

Concerts, outings, exhibitions and parades all make up this year’s edition of Barcelona Harley Days, which will take place from the 5th to the 7th of July

With over one hundred years of history, the famous motorbikes from the North American manufacturer Harley Davidson still fascinate enthusiasts the world over. So much so, in fact, that a festival in honour of these unique motorcycles, Barcelona Harley Days, has been a regular feature in the city for several years.
 
From the 5th to the 7th of July, the Montjuïc and Fira de Barcelona areas of the city will be handed over to enthusiasts and other interested parties who wish to partake in these days of Harley Davidson ambience, homage and activities. Entry is free of charge.
 
As is customary, the highlight of the event will be the Parade of Flags which, on Sunday the 7th, will cause the streets of the city centre to thunder with the roar of 13,000 motorbikes of all makes and models.
 
Music will also play an important part in the festivities and there will be a number of rock concerts by amateur bands who were winners of the competition initiated by Harley Davidson on their official Facebook page some weeks ago. The line-up will include RedElm, Steepers, Lost Romanes, The Sparkles and Lucky Dados as well as celebrity heavy metal singer Rafa Blas.
 
Barcelona Harley Days will also include exhibitions, guided tours, custom bike displays, a Country Music Day and an Elvis Day, with tribute concerts to the legendary King of Rock ‘n’ Roll.
